Skip to content

khatribharat/SimpleFTPServer

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

1 Commit
 
 
 
 
 
 

Repository files navigation

//#################################
1. To compile the server
(a)	cd server
(b)	make clean; make all

2. To compile the client
(a)	cd client
(b)	make clean; make all


//###################################


//###### User Manual ###############

1) get file : get a file (file name specified) from server current directory to client current directory.

:: USAGE ::

ftp> GET/get <filename> 
-----------------------------------------------------------------------------------------------------------

2) put file     : put a file (file name specified) to server current directory from client current directory.

:: USAGE ::

ftp> PUT/put <filename> 
-------------------------------------------------------------------------------------------------------------

3) mget file    : gets multiple files (file name specified) from server current  directory to client current directory.

:: USAGE ::

ftp> MGET/mget <filename>,<filename>,<filename>,.. 
--------------------------------------------------------------------------------------------------------------

4) mput file    : puts multiple files (file name specified) to server current  directory from client current directory.

:: USAGE ::

ftp> mput/MPUT <filename>,<filename>,<filename> 
-------------------------------------------------------------------------------------------------------------

5) cd dir       : change server current directory.

:: USAGE ::

ftp> CD/cd <pathname> 
-------------------------------------------------------------------------------------------------------------

6) lcd dir      : change client local current directory.

:: USAGE ::

ftp> LCD/lcd <pathname> 
-------------------------------------------------------------------------------------------------------------


7) mget *       : mget with wildcard support.

:: USAGE ::

ftp> mget/MGET *
-------------------------------------------------------------------------------------------------------------

8) mput *       : mput with wildcard support.

:: USAGE ::

ftp> mput/MPUT *
-------------------------------------------------------------------------------------------------------------

9) dir          : Show the content of servers current directory.

:: USAGE ::

ftp> DIR/dir
-------------------------------------------------------------------------------------------------------------

10) ldir        : Show the content of clients current directory.

:: USAGE ::

ftp> LDIR/ldir
-------------------------------------------------------------------------------------------------------------

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Packages

No packages published

Languages